Abstract
All available magnetic data from observatories, satellites, repeat station measurements, and aeromagnetic, shipborne and land surveys are used to derive spherical harmonic models of the geomagnetic field from 1970 to 1990. Two models are derived, designated GSFC(11/90)D and GSFC(11/90) respectively. Main field coefficients are determined up to degree 13 and temporal variation, represented by B-splines, up to degree 10. Bias values at the fixed observatories were included as part of the solution. The secular variation models are smoothed by use of norm minimization. The resulting secular variation shows a jerk-like trend change in several coefficients near 1979. -from Authors
